early 20th century antique american residential entrance door "new departure" mechanical doorbell rotating "finger twist" handle likely fabricated by the new departure mfg. co., bristol, ct. retains the original rococo style flush mount backplate containing two screw holes that flank the protruding knob. rotating the knob or t-handle, either to the right or left, communicates to the hammer-shaft (creating a rapid rotary motion), whereby the hammers are caused to strike the inner surface of the bell or gong in rapid succession. doorbell not included. minor surface rust and faint traces of the original copper-plated finish. measures approximately 4 1/4 x 1 5/8 inches.
